Eclipse中深度探索Android应用程序开发与调试
需积分: 9 44 浏览量
更新于2024-09-22
收藏 1.05MB PDF 举报
"这篇教程详细讲解了如何在Eclipse中开发和调试Android应用程序,以HelloAndroidWorld项目为例,涵盖了Android工程的结构解析和调试方法。同时,提到了Android SDK Platform Honeycomb Preview的更新,强调了使用最新技术进行学习和开发的重要性。"
在Android应用程序开发中,Eclipse是一个广泛使用的集成开发环境(IDE),它提供了丰富的工具和功能,使得开发者能够高效地编写、测试和调试代码。在Eclipse中开发Android应用,首先需要正确配置Android开发环境,包括安装Eclipse(这里提到的是Helios版本)、Android SDK以及ADT(Android Development Tools)插件。
创建一个Android工程后,Eclipse会自动生成一系列默认文件和目录,这些文件和目录构成了Android项目的结构。例如,`src`目录存放Java源代码,`res`目录包含应用的资源如布局文件、图片、字符串等,`AndroidManifest.xml`文件定义了应用的基本属性和权限,`gen`目录则包含了由R.java文件,它是编译器生成的,用于访问资源的ID。
在Eclipse中,调试Android应用程序主要通过设置断点、查看变量值、控制程序流程等方式进行。断点可以在源代码的行号上单击鼠标左键设置,当程序运行到断点时,会暂停,允许开发者检查当前状态。Eclipse的调试视图(Debug Perspective)提供了对堆栈、线程和变量的详细视图,帮助开发者理解和追踪问题。
本教程还提及了Android SDK Platform Honeycomb Preview,这是一个针对平板电脑优化的Android版本,提供了更适合大屏幕设备的界面和功能。使用预览版SDK可以让开发者提前了解和适配新特性,尽管预览版可能存在不稳定或未完善的因素,但这也是开发者保持技术领先和适应未来趋势的重要步骤。
在Android 3.0 Honeycomb中,谷歌引入了许多改进,比如改进的多任务处理、新的UI设计、更好的硬件加速支持,以及针对开发者的一系列API更新。这使得开发者能构建更高效、更美观的平板应用。随着SDK的不断更新,开发者可以持续优化和提升应用的性能和用户体验。
通过Eclipse进行Android开发和调试是一个全面且复杂的过程,涉及环境配置、项目结构理解、代码编写、调试技巧等多个方面。而保持对新版本SDK的关注和学习,可以帮助开发者紧跟Android平台的发展,提高应用的竞争力。
200 浏览量
点击了解资源详情
点击了解资源详情
2012-06-08 上传
202 浏览量
173 浏览量
200 浏览量
2013-08-10 上传
2022-07-06 上传
sanfran_qi
- 粉丝: 6
- 资源: 26
最新资源
- Potlatch_Server:看一场你无法独享的日落; 一幅让你叹为观止的风景,一幅触动你个人的画面? 然后拍摄一张照片,添加一些文字或诗歌来传达您的想法,然后使用 Potlatch 将其提供给其他人。 你的想法和图像能触动世界各地的人们吗? 谁是最伟大的礼物赠送者? 用 Potlatch 找出答案。 (potlatch这个词来自奇努克的行话,意思是“赠送”或“礼物”,是加拿大和美国太平洋西北海岸原住民举行的送礼盛宴)
- 可爱小老虎图标下载
- 虚拟舞蹈委员会
- applifecycle-backend-e2e:应用程序生命周期后端的e2e测试库
- AP-Elektronica-ICT:AP Hogeschool Antwerp的电子信息通信技术课程的公共GitHub页面
- USBWriter-1.3的源码
- AdBlockID-Plus_realodix:AdBlockID Plus测试
- 初级java笔试题-english-dictionary:英语词典
- vue-height-tween-transition:补间过渡项目的父项的高度
- 搞怪松鼠图标下载
- minimal-app:最小的Phonegap应用
- libmp3lame.a(3.100).zip
- 多彩变色龙图标下载
- 实现可以扫描生成二维码的功能
- LittleProjects:Coursera的Little Projects
- SingleInstanceApp:WPF单实例应用程序